"Somewhere in my wildest childhood I must have done something right. Being able to make a boyhood dream come true is one thing, but to have a kid come along and thrill his dad like Brett Hull has thrilled me over his career is too much for one guy to handle"
About this Quote
The quote lands because it’s really about inheritance, not achievement. Hull draws a clean line between “a boyhood dream” and the far stranger experience of watching your child live an even bigger one. It’s the athlete’s version of being outpaced by your own legacy. The kicker is that he doesn’t say Brett Hull is better; he says Brett “thrills his dad,” shifting the spotlight from competition to awe. For a father who was once the center of the hockey universe, the emotional flex is admitting he can be reduced to a fan in the stands.
“Too much for one guy to handle” is performative overflow - a tough-guy culture allowing tenderness by framing it as overload. The subtext is permission: even icons get to be moved, even fathers get to be proud without sounding soft. Context matters too: this isn’t just a family moment; it’s hockey royalty protecting its lineage, turning a personal thrill into a public seal of continuity.
